/*
 * Broker upgrade notes (Marlinq 3 -> 4) for the release manager.
 * The new broker changes default prefetch and ack behavior, so we
 * pin everything explicitly here rather than trusting defaults.
 * Consumers must be drained before cutover; the migration script
 * checks queue depth against the thresholds below and aborts if
 * exceeded. Do not edit these mid-release — they are read once at
 * startup by every worker. The constants governing the upgrade
 * window are as follows.
 */

tuning constants:
QUOTAS = {
    "druwyn": 5,
    "holix": 5,
    "zorath": 5,
    "holwyn": 10,
}

Handover note — Dellwick Station receiving

Tom, before I head off: the spare parts crate for the Harrowmere pump house is packed and strapped — two impellers, a seal kit, and the replacement control board for the Aquastral unit. It's staged by the loading door, labelled in red. Keep it inside until the Ridgeline courier arrives; the board is moisture-sensitive and shouldn't sit on the dock. The site foreman, Petra, knows it's coming Friday. When the courier shows up, use the confidential hand-over instruction noted just below.

dispatch memo: the eliath belael courier leaves the praox ledger at gate 8841 under passcode 017589

# Artifact Signing — Hermetic Migration (Quillworks Build)

All artifacts from the new hermetic builder must be signed inside the sandbox; network fetches are blocked, so the signing material is injected at graph load. If verification fails on promote, confirm the sandbox manifest pins the current key epoch, then rerun `qb sign --verify`. The builder trusts exactly one key per epoch. The current epoch key is listed below.

signing key of yajog-kafof = bky19_orbYRY3Abj3KpZesMie

Ticket: RateGuard parity checker dropping connections

Parity scans against the Tollhouse feed fail after ~200 requests with pool exhaustion. Root cause: connections never returned on scrape timeout. Fix: wrap scraper in context with 30s deadline. Until patched, restart the worker hourly. For manual verification, connect to the parity DB with the string below.

replica DSN, kajep-yahag: mssql://praok_svc:iF@db-8d68.plorvaio.local:5432/eliion